Factors Impacting Stem Cell Treatment Costs: What to Think About

Undergoing stem cell treatment can be a complex and costly journey. The price tag for these procedures varies widely depending on several crucial factors. A key consideration is the category of stem cells used, with adult stem cells generally being less pricey than embryonic stem cells. The severity of your condition also plays a role, as more complex treatments naturally command higher costs. Geographic location can influence prices due to differences in regulatory standards and market pressure. Additional factors include the reputation of the facility, the number of treatment sessions required, and any associated medical costs. It's crucial to thoroughly research and compare different providers to determine the most cost-effective and suitable option for your individual needs.

Stem Cell Therapy Insurance: Promise and Practice

Access to innovative approaches like stem cell therapy often hinges on the complex interplay between medical necessity, scientific acceptance, and insurance coverage. Patients frequently harbor high expectations regarding insurance imbursement, envisioning a seamless path to these potentially transformative therapies. However, the reality often proves more complex. Stem cell therapy remains an evolving field, with ongoing investigation striving to define its efficacy and safety for various conditions. This uncertainty can present hindrances for insurers in determining appropriate coverage policies.

  • As a result, many patients face considerable financial responsibilities when pursuing stem cell therapy, often requiring out-of-pocket expenses that can be substantial.
  • Moreover, the lack of standardized guidelines and regulatory frameworks for stem cell therapies complicates the insurance assessment process.

Navigating this landscape requires patients to engage in informed discussions with their healthcare providers, negotiate actively with insurance companies, and explore alternative resource options.
